Once in there, the first thing John did was to pull out a tape recorder and get Katie to recite the lines that he'd prepared in advance for the fake answer phone message about Katie being chased by a man with a knife.
At just nine years old, Katie already knew that this was no ordinary playdate that she'd be home in time for dinner from.
She asked John how long he planned to keep her there, and his response was, forever.
John told Katie that this was her home now, and for the next 17 days, it was.
Katie's new living conditions were like something out of an actual horror movie Halloween nightmare.
She slept inside the box, in nothing but 101 Dalmatians 90, and just a thin blanket and a tiny pillow.
In the corner of what we called the larger chamber, there was a disconnected toilet that had been filled with a black bin bag for Katie to use.
And while somehow, I do not know how she managed this, but Katie had actually managed to find and hide from John a spare key to the coffin that she was locked in.
She somehow managed to get her hands on that and she hides it in her blanket, which did give her access to the larger room at any time, even when John was out of the house.
But, and this just shows you how intelligent Katie is at just 10 years old, barely 10.
She's nine when she's abducted.
Her birthday hasn't happened yet.
Because she knows that even though she lets herself out of that coffin box and into the larger chamber, she doesn't use the toilet when he's not there.
Because she knows that if she does, he'll come back and realize that she's somehow getting out.
So she would actually soil herself in her coffin space, which obviously filled her, as she talks about in her own book that she's written since, an intense feeling of shame and absolutely just adding layer upon layer upon layer to the nightmarish situation that she's already in.
